Out of work, out of luck, Ed Hawkins seeks fame and fortune by becoming a Sporting Chancer.

Attempting to wager his way around the world, he wins and loses with hilarious consequences. Amongst other jaunts he plays tennis with John McEnroe, darts against Phil Taylor and ends up at an illegal cockfight in Louisiana with Britney Spears’ babysitter.

Setting himself three challenges to see if he can become a true Sporting Chancer, the fun never runs out – unlike the funds.

An occasionally entertaining and quick read for the holidays. Mostly a description of the largely unsuccessful sports betting exploits of the author across a number of stops around the world, starting with an Ashes tour to Australia. Definitely, a third star only for people who enjoy their Cricket. Sadly, there is also no deep insights gleaned by the author, neither for himself, nor (but for a few small reflections towards the end) for others.
